Exagen Inc. (NASDAQ: XGN) reported preliminary unaudited financial results for 2025, showing total revenue between $66 million and $67 million for the full year, representing growth of 19% to 20% compared to 2024.
The autoimmune testing company reported fourth quarter revenue of $16 million to $17 million, reflecting year-over-year growth of 17% to 24%. The company's AVISE CTD test volume reached 136,000 to 137,000 for the year, an increase of at least 13,000 tests or 11% over 2024.
The company's AVISE CTD trailing 12-month average selling price expanded to $441 to $445, representing an increase of at least $30 compared to 2024. Exagen ended the year with $32 million in cash and cash equivalents, a $10 million increase from 2024.
The preliminary results are based on currently available information and financial closing procedures are not yet complete. The company's independent registered public accounting firm has not audited or reviewed the preliminary financial information.
"Based upon our preliminary results, we delivered significant topline growth, driven by both volume and ASP expansion, despite unexpected ASP headwinds in the second half of the year," said John Aballi, President and CEO.
Exagen specializes in autoimmune diagnostics, with its flagship AVISE CTD test used to diagnose conditions including lupus, rheumatoid arthritis, and Sjögren's syndrome. The company is based in Carlsbad, California.
